UK Sustainable Fisheries Data Analyst: Job Market Outlook

Career Role Description
Fisheries Data Scientist Develops and implements advanced statistical models for sustainable fisheries management, analyzing large datasets to inform policy and conservation efforts. Requires strong programming skills (R, Python) and expertise in data mining.
Marine Data Analyst Collects, processes, and analyzes diverse marine data, including catch statistics, environmental parameters, and biological information, to support sustainable fisheries practices. Requires proficiency in data visualization and GIS.
Fisheries Stock Assessment Analyst Evaluates fish populations using statistical methods and modelling techniques, providing critical input for setting catch limits and managing fishing quotas for sustainable resource use. Requires expertise in population dynamics and fisheries science.
Sustainable Fisheries Consultant Provides expert advice on sustainable fisheries practices to government agencies, NGOs, and the fishing industry. Requires strong communication, analytical, and problem-solving skills, along with a deep understanding of fisheries management policies.
